Indoor localization is a prerequisite for LBS(Location Based Services), is research hotspot in recent years, and received widespread attention from academia and industry. With the popularity of smart phones, many kinds of indoor localization method which is based on WiFi and Smart Phone have been proposed. Compared with the previous localization method, indoor localization based on WiFi and Smart Phone has advantages, but still exits some problem such as the cost of manual collection is higher.This thesis summarized and compared from the key factors for large scale apply of indoor localization, the basic method of indoor localization based on WiFi and smart mobile phone and classification of indoor localization, and then pointed the issues and the future trends in this field. Then, we propose a location method based on fingerprint refinement according to the WiFi indoor distribution characteristics and the divide and conquer technique. This method can achieve idea positioning accuracy while greatly reduces the cost of collecting samples. Finally, this paper implements a simulation system for indoor positioning, it can be used to visual analyze and process sampler data, and also can be used to refined sample data.In this thesis, we use refinement data and simulation system to do the experiment. The experiment show that the higher precision sample data caused the lower average distance, when use the data refined to 0.25 meters and the K-nearest neighbor matching algorithm(K=4) the average positioning error distance is 1.82785 meters. Thus show that use our method can achieve idea positioning accuracy while greatly reduces the cost of collecting samples.
